Now according to a report from IGN, it seems that if you own an Xbox One console, thanks to the IDW Comics app, you will be able to download comics for free. While consoles might have originally designed to be gaming machines for the living room, over the years we’ve started to see console makers like Sony and Microsoft add more non-gaming features, such as social features and entertainment features like watching videos and surfing the web.
